diff options
Diffstat (limited to 'pkgs/development/tools/misc')
-rw-r--r-- | pkgs/development/tools/misc/cscope/default.nix | 2 | ||||
-rw-r--r-- | pkgs/development/tools/misc/gdb/default.nix | 4 | ||||
-rw-r--r-- | pkgs/development/tools/misc/global/default.nix | 4 | ||||
-rw-r--r-- | pkgs/development/tools/misc/patchelf/setup-hook.sh | 2 | ||||
-rw-r--r-- | pkgs/development/tools/misc/uhd/default.nix | 2 |
5 files changed, 8 insertions, 6 deletions
diff --git a/pkgs/development/tools/misc/cscope/default.nix b/pkgs/development/tools/misc/cscope/default.nix index 223f19682746..4685787af5f7 100644 --- a/pkgs/development/tools/misc/cscope/default.nix +++ b/pkgs/development/tools/misc/cscope/default.nix @@ -15,7 +15,7 @@ stdenv.mkDerivation rec { -"es|\"cscope-indexer\"|\"$out/libexec/cscope/cscope-indexer\"|g"; ''; - configureFlags = "--with-ncurses=${ncurses}"; + configureFlags = "--with-ncurses=${ncurses.dev}"; buildInputs = [ ncurses ]; nativeBuildInputs = [ pkgconfig emacs ]; diff --git a/pkgs/development/tools/misc/gdb/default.nix b/pkgs/development/tools/misc/gdb/default.nix index 472bb4de58b9..6635044ce674 100644 --- a/pkgs/development/tools/misc/gdb/default.nix +++ b/pkgs/development/tools/misc/gdb/default.nix @@ -44,8 +44,8 @@ stdenv.mkDerivation rec { enableParallelBuilding = true; configureFlags = with stdenv.lib; - [ "--with-gmp=${gmp}" "--with-mpfr=${mpfr}" "--with-system-readline" - "--with-system-zlib" "--with-expat" "--with-libexpat-prefix=${expat}" + [ "--with-gmp=${gmp.dev}" "--with-mpfr=${mpfr.dev}" "--with-system-readline" + "--with-system-zlib" "--with-expat" "--with-libexpat-prefix=${expat.dev}" "--with-separate-debug-dir=/run/current-system/sw/lib/debug" ] ++ optional (target != null) "--target=${target.config}" diff --git a/pkgs/development/tools/misc/global/default.nix b/pkgs/development/tools/misc/global/default.nix index e6b81ca7eb17..3d09bc92cd30 100644 --- a/pkgs/development/tools/misc/global/default.nix +++ b/pkgs/development/tools/misc/global/default.nix @@ -19,8 +19,8 @@ stdenv.mkDerivation rec { configureFlags = [ "--with-ltdl-include=${libtool}/include" "--with-ltdl-lib=${libtool.lib}/lib" - "--with-ncurses=${ncurses}" - "--with-sqlite3=${sqlite}" + "--with-ncurses=${ncurses.dev}" + "--with-sqlite3=${sqlite.dev}" "--with-exuberant-ctags=${ctags}/bin/ctags" "--with-posix-sort=${coreutils}/bin/sort" ]; diff --git a/pkgs/development/tools/misc/patchelf/setup-hook.sh b/pkgs/development/tools/misc/patchelf/setup-hook.sh index 563ef57fce11..bc1cddd4879c 100644 --- a/pkgs/development/tools/misc/patchelf/setup-hook.sh +++ b/pkgs/development/tools/misc/patchelf/setup-hook.sh @@ -6,6 +6,8 @@ fixupOutputHooks+=('if [ -z "$dontPatchELF" ]; then patchELF "$prefix"; fi') patchELF() { local dir="$1" + [ -e "$dir" ] || return 0 + header "shrinking RPATHs of ELF executables and libraries in $dir" local i diff --git a/pkgs/development/tools/misc/uhd/default.nix b/pkgs/development/tools/misc/uhd/default.nix index 786a7d8cdb51..9c0d81cf0043 100644 --- a/pkgs/development/tools/misc/uhd/default.nix +++ b/pkgs/development/tools/misc/uhd/default.nix @@ -23,7 +23,7 @@ stdenv.mkDerivation rec { enableParallelBuilding = true; - cmakeFlags = "-DLIBUSB_INCLUDE_DIRS=${libusb1}/include/libusb-1.0"; + cmakeFlags = "-DLIBUSB_INCLUDE_DIRS=${libusb1.dev}/include/libusb-1.0"; nativeBuildInputs = [ cmake pkgconfig ]; buildInputs = [ python pythonPackages.pyramid_mako orc libusb1 boost ]; |